
(26/08/2013) Philips Entertainment is powering up its premier lighting brands - Selecon, Showline and Strand Lighting - for IBC 2013 (Hall 11, Stand G81) from 13-17 September at Amsterdams RAI
Exhibition and Convention Centre.
Representatives from each of the Philips brands will be on-stand to demonstrate the full range of professional media and entertainment luminaires and control products including the PL range of LED luminaires from Philips Selecon. Ideal for TV Studios, small theatre, museums and multipurpose venues the PLCyc2 offers twin single source 120 watts RGBW LED engines (the PLCyc1 offers a single source 120 watts RGBW LED engine), which enables truly inventive, totally consistent colour mixing for stunning cyc and wash lighting effects.
Offering a smooth, even beam, the PLCyc1 and PLCyc2 seamlessly blend intense washes of colour on cycloramas up to 5m high and 10m high respectively, says Selecons senior sales manager Grant Bales-Smith. Using LED source technology combined with a properly shaped asymmetrical reflector, the PLCyc1 and PLCyc2 deliver consistent light distribution without requiring the compromising performance of vertical or horizontal spreader lenses. Not only that all PLCyc luminaires support wireless DMX512 control, available via Wireless Solutions. Each optional wireless receiver also has a DMX512 out-port to control adjacent luminaires.
In addition, the new PLprofile4 LED luminaire will join the PL LED lighting range, including the PLfresnel1 and the PLprofile1. The PLprofile4 combines the same LED source technology, which is applied across the PL range, with precision optical design. Four 120Watt high-power, RGBW LED engines deliver super-bright colour options with exact beam control and pattern projection.
Joining the PL range will be Selecons already popular, broadcast-focused Studio Panel. This offers a compact lightweight LED solution that is designed for both studio and location use. Units feature tunable white colour temperature control from 3000K to 6000K - making it ideal for a wide range of lighting applications. Requiring just 50 watts, the unit will operate on AC or DC voltage. The battery power input is designed to allow location operation using industry standard batteries. Plus, a range of specialist holographic diffusers can provide beam angle control with minimal light loss.
Complementing the Philips Selecon range on stand will be the highly acclaimed Showline range including the SL NITRO 510 LED strobe. This unique fixture delivers super bright, intense bursts of light and dynamic effects via over 1300 high-powered LEDs. Not only that, its continuous on operation along with six unique zones of control allow total flexibility, while unique built in chases aid creativity and simplicity.
With over 68,000 lumens of output, the SL NITRO 510 rivals conventional strobes and retains dynamic looks whether washing a stage or pointing directly at an audience. Additionally several other Showline products will be on display including the SL BAR 660, SL BAND 300, SL PAR 150 ZOOM and more.
Showline will also be exhibiting its new SL BAR 640: Offering designers a complete lighting tool, the SL BAR 640 produces over 13,000 lumens of output and features a 60 degree beam angle, built-in effects and chases, an auto-orienting LCD menu, multiple dimming curves and colour modes, full RDM implementation, a unique strobe control paradigm, plus industry standard Powercon in/out and 5-pin DMX connectors. The 4-foot SL BAR 640 delivers exceptional light output and endless creative possibilities.
Finally, offering control that can easily cope with a hybrid of luminaires, Philips Strand Lighting will be exhibiting the versatile 250ML moving light control console - an evolution of the popular Strand series 200 console. It features four encoders and an LCD display screen for quick and easy automated lighting and LED control making it ideal for smaller productions using a range of lighting instruments and sources.
